
java中的运行插件有哪些
常见问答
Java插件运行时如何管理性能?
在Java应用程序中使用插件时,应该如何管理和优化插件的运行性能?
优化Java插件运行性能的方法
Java插件的性能管理可以通过合理设计插件接口、限制资源使用、使用高效的数据结构以及避免内存泄漏等方式实现。此外,使用Java虚拟机的监控和调试工具,如JVisualVM,可以帮助识别性能瓶颈并进行优化。
Java运行插件时如何确保安全性?
在运行Java插件时,如何防止恶意代码影响主应用的安全?
提高Java插件安全性的措施
为了保障Java插件运行的安全,建议采用沙箱机制限制插件访问权限,使用权限管理器控制插件操作,进行代码签名验证,同时定期更新和审查插件代码,防止注入恶意代码或未经授权的访问。
有哪些常用的Java插件框架?
Java开发中常用的插件框架有哪些,适合不同场景的推荐是?
Java常用插件框架推荐
常用的Java插件框架包括OSGi、Apache Felix、PF4J和Spring插件等。OSGi适合模块化开发,支持动态加载;PF4J轻量且易用,适合简单的插件管理需求;Spring插件适合基于Spring的企业应用。选择合适的框架需根据项目规模和需求决定。